Women’s Basketball Lose 59-41 Against New York Tech

OLD WESTBURY, N.Y. – The University of the District of Columbia Women's Basketball Team fell short in their East Coast Conference battle losing 59-41 to New York Tech on Wednesday evening.

The Firebirds (7-16, 3-8 ECC), came up against an in form Tech side who have put together a three game winning streak to continue their fight for the ECC Championships. The confidence in the home team showed in the first quarter when The Bears took an early 18-7 lead into the second quarter and left the Firebirds with an uphill task ahead of them.

The second quarter was much cagier with both sides struggling to put the points on the board leaving the score at the end of the half, 28-16. However, the Firebirds fighting spirit came in the fourth quarter as they were led by Maya Thomas who scored 13 points in the game; nine of those points came in the fourth quarter. She was also aided by Hunter Rowson who scored seven points in the final period.

UDC will be back in action this weekend when they host East Coast Conference rivals, The University of Bridgeport on Saturday February 15th, 1PM at the UDC Gymnasium.
